Bus Tickets from Ontario, CA to Niagara Falls, CA

Previously seen trips

Next departures for Ontario to Niagara Falls on November 16
Operated byVehicle typeDeparture timeDeparture locationTrip durationArrival timeArrival locationRecommendedPrice and booking link
FlixBus + Greyhound
Bus
Montclair (Ontario)
Niagara Falls CanadaNo tags
Greyhound + FlixBus
Bus
Montclair (Ontario)
Niagara Falls CanadaNo tags
Greyhound + FlixBus
Bus
Montclair (Ontario)
Niagara Falls CanadaNo tags
Greyhound + FlixBus
Bus
Montclair (Ontario)
Niagara Falls Canada (Rapidsview)No tags
Greyhound + FlixBus
Bus
Montclair (Ontario)
Niagara Falls Canada (Rapidsview)No tags

Get from Ontario to Niagara Falls

This route is served by bus only

The journey takes about 3 days, 2 hours 35 minutes, and with fares starting at just $374, it presents an excellent value for a comfortable ride.

6bus per day
3d 2hAverage Duration
3469 kmDistance
87kgCO₂ emissions

Frequently asked questions about travelling from Ontario, CA to Niagara Falls, CA by bus

  1. What is the distance between Ontario and Niagara Falls?

    It's about 3471 km (2153 miles) from Ontario to Niagara Falls.

  2. What are the departure and arrival locations for buses traveling from Ontario to Niagara Falls?

    Buses departing from Ontario California Bus Stop Carl's Jr & Teriyaki House in Ontario will take you to Bus Terminal - 4555 Erie Ave in Niagara Falls.

People from around the world trust Busbud

Popular Buses Connecting Ontario

Buses Leaving from Ontario

Buses Going to Ontario

Popular Buses Connecting Niagara Falls

Buses Leaving from Niagara Falls

Buses Going to Niagara Falls